# Retrax

Retrax is a standalone observability companion that can be attached to any application. Retrax lets user to:

\- See every AI agent workflow run that your application executed

\- Open a single run and trace it step by step — the execution graph, the time waterfall, and the call tree

\- Inspect each step in detail: LLM calls, tool inputs/outputs, dependencies, tokens, and durations

\- Debug failed runs, find slow steps, and audit exactly what the AI read and did

#### Graph View

A node graph of the run, with arrows connecting steps. It includes collapsible groups, guardrail badges, nested-step counters, and a final-result card.

**User can perform several actions:**

1. **Zoom In / Out** — click the `+` / `−` buttons, or hold the mouse over the graph and scroll the wheel for smooth zoom.
2. **Fit View** — click *Fit View* to fit the whole graph into the visible area.
3. **Pan** — click and drag empty canvas to move around.
4. **Mini Map** — click a region of the mini map to jump there.
5. **Toggle Interactivity** (lock icon) — lock/unlock the canvas to prevent or allow moving node positions.

#### Waterfall View

**What it shows:**A time diagram of spans. Each row is a span with its name, type, duration and sometimes tokens. Groups are collapsible. Controls include **Critical path**, **Reset zoom**, a zoom-window slider, and hints *"⇧ drag to zoom · ⌘ wheel"*.

[![](https://wiki.slaq.ai/uploads/images/gallery/2026-07/scaled-1680-/image-1783097829523.png)](https://wiki.slaq.ai/uploads/images/gallery/2026-07/image-1783097829523.png)

#### Tree View

A hierarchical *Trace tree*. Each node has a type icon, a name, an iteration label a duration, tokens (for LLM nodes) and tool-call counters. Branches are expandable.

**User can perform several actions**

1. Open the **Tree** view to see the hierarchy from the root down.
2. Click a node's **expand arrow** to reveal its children; click again to collapse.
3. Read repeated steps by their numbering — numbering is sequential.
4. Read iteration labels — they follow the execution order.
5. Read per-node metrics on LLM nodes — duration and tokens.
6. Click any node to load its details into the **Inspector**; the selection syncs with Graph and Waterfall.
7. Expand the deepest branch to verify structure — indentation stays correct, with no truncation.

# Side Panels

##### Inspector / Details

The Inspector (opened via the **Details** side panel) shows everything about the currently selected node. It has a **Pretty / JSON** toggle and displays the node's type and status (e.g. *LLM\_CALL · COMPLETED*), name, an ownership line (*"in {parent} · Iter N · {duration}"*), a *Final results* block, and collapsible sections.

User can close it with the **×**.

#### Tool I/O

The **Tool I/O** panel shows the input and output of a tool call.

##### Input

The **INPUT** block shows the parameters the tool was called with. Its header carries the payload **size** and a **Pretty / JSON** toggle, then each parameter is listed as a name/value pair.

[![](https://wiki.slaq.ai/uploads/images/gallery/2026-07/scaled-1680-/image-1783101803962.png)](https://wiki.slaq.ai/uploads/images/gallery/2026-07/image-1783101803962.png)

##### Output

The **OUTPUT** block shows the result. Its header also carries the **size** and a **Pretty / JSON** toggle. When the result is structured, Retrax lays it out as **collapsible sections** — so a big response stays readable instead of dumping a wall of JSON.

##### Dependencies (Deps)

The **Dependencies** panel reveals scheduling dependencies between nodes.

**User can perform several types of actions:**

1. Click **Deps** to open the dependencies panel / mode.
2. Find a node marked *"Has scheduling dependencies"* — the indicator confirms it has them.
3. Select a node that has dependencies — its related nodes / edges are highlighted.
4. Select an independent node — no dependencies are shown (empty), confirming it isn't waiting on anything.

##### LLM Call

When user selects an LLM node, the middle side-panel button becomes **LLM call**.

Opening it shows the details of that model call:

- **model** and provider (e.g. *claude-sonnet-4-6 · BEDROCK*)
- a timestamp
- a status
- a token breakdown
- raw prompt/response.
